DETAILED DESCRIPTION OF THE INVENTION This invention relates to improvements in elevator safety devices.

In automatically operated elevators, especially residential elevators, children may play by getting into the car when it arrives at the elevator. In this case, there are the following dangers:

(a) Elevator doors begin to close automatically after a certain amount of time has passed since they were opened. At this time, the child in the car hurriedly tries to get out to the boarding area and falls over, injuring himself.

(b) When the above-mentioned door starts to close, if you touch the door safety switch (a well-known switch installed on the front edge of the door that activates when touched), the door will flip open. If you keep holding onto the door, your hand will get caught in the door bag and you will get injured.

(c) Once the door has been closed, it will continue to close unless there is a call from another floor, and the child will be temporarily trapped in the cage, giving the child a great sense of fear.

(d) In the case of (c), if there is a call from another floor, the car will run, but if something breaks down at this time, the child will be completely trapped. Moreover, since they are children, they are unable to communicate with the outside world, and out of fear they may try to open the car door and get out, putting them at risk of falling into the hoistway.

The present invention aims to improve the above-mentioned problems and to provide a safety device for an elevator that can prevent accidents by detecting when a child accidentally gets into a car.

As explained above, this invention provides entry/exit detectors at the low and high positions of the car entrance and exit, and when the low position detector operates when no destination button in the car is operated, a child may be tampered with boarding. Since the system detects this, prevents the door from closing, and notifies the outside of the car that the car has been tampered with, it is possible to prevent accidents caused by children tampering with the car.

An unoccupied detection circuit that detects that no destination button in the car has been operated; an entrance/exit detector installed at a low position and a high position of the entrance/exit of the car to detect a person passing through the entrance/exit; A safety device for an elevator comprising a child tampering entry detection circuit which prevents the entrance/exit door from being closed when only the lower one of the entry/exit detectors operates when the circuit is operating.
